OROS Rotary Balancing Software

Description
The OROS Balancing Solution will let any machine (rotors, axles and shafts), be balanced on one or two planes. The method uses two measurements of the vibration at the bearings: one under initial conditions and one using a trial mass for a one plane balancing and a second one for two plane balancing. Main Features Balancing on 1 or 2 planes 1 or 2 sensors on each planes: horizontal and vertical Based on synchronous order analysis Balancing quality selection Correction positions choice Balancing prognosis Test based on a rugged portable analyzer for field measurements Report generation
